Our recurring service project for the year will be filling bags with food for the weekends for children 6th grade and below that are on food assistance in five area schools.  We will refill the food bins with food, as well as assist in delivering bags to schools.
 
This service project will take place on the 3rd Saturday of each month.  We will meet at Aldersgate United Methodist Church, 360 Robert Blvd., Slidell at the first door of the first building on the left.  Our project will only last one hour - 9:00 am - 10:00 am.  We can have as many as 8 volunteers each session. 
 
Events will be created each month, allowing volunteers (including friends and family) to sign up so we'll know how many people to expect.  This project is being funded by one of our District grants and matching funds from our club.  We appreciate your support!
